Last month, Indiana passed HB 1337, an anti abortion bill so restrictive, even many pro-life Republicans are against it.

Unlike other anti-abortion restrictions, Indiana’s is unique in that it’s not only extremely costly and requires an ultrasound with audio of the fetus’s heartbeat followed by an 18 hour waiting period before the procedure, it will also ban women from seeking an abortion based on fetal diagnosis, prohibits doctors from knowingly aborting fetuses based on physical abnormalities by making it a felony AND requires women to pay for the cremation or interment of aborted fetuses. Under HB 1337, abortion is prohibited based on the “(1) race, color, national ancestry or sex of the fetus; or (2) a diagnosis or penitential diagnosis of the fetus having Down Syndrome or any other disability.” South Dakota is the only other state to prohibit abortions based on physical diagnosis. The bill was approved by the House of Representatives in a 60-40 vote, and Republican Governor Mike Pence, who has since signed the bill into law, is a “strong supporter of the right to life.

In response to this horrible violation of women’s rights, the women of Indiana have been calling Governor Pence’s office and informing him the details of their menstrual cycle. If he’s so interested in women’s bodies, he ought to know just how bloody the women of Idiana’s periods are, right?

Twitter and Facebook accounts Periods for Pence were created to assist in contacting Governor Pence as often as possible.
